Take One Tablet...
OK, keep in mind that most Apple rumors on the internet aren't worth the paper they're printed on. Also keep in mind that Jobs said not that long ago that Apple had developed a PDA but had decided not to sell it (though this isn't strictly a PDA). Of course, you can also keep in mind the fact that Apple not that long ago dug up the handwriting recognition software from the Newton (still the best ever developed) and adapted it to work with OS X as Inkwell. With those caveats firmly in mind, I thought this is kind of interesting: Apple has filed for a European design trademark which may provide a tantalising glimpse of the company's long-awaited tablet computer. ... The filing ... covers a "handheld computer" and contains sketches of what look like an iBook screen minus the body of the computer. The drawing, of course, could be of anything--it could just as easily be a wireless monitor, which has been rumored before. And, even if the filing does in fact say it's a handheld computer, it could be paperwork filed in connection with the developed-but-killed PDA. In the meantime, it's an interesting Apple rumor.
